What indoor plants need in a Westlake Hills home
Westlake Hills is built into the steep hills just across the river from downtown, and over the last decade a huge share of its homes have been renovated or rebuilt into bright, modern showpieces — soaring windows, open volumes, and walls of glass catching the afternoon sun off the hills. Beautiful homes, and a specific challenge for houseplants.
That west- and south-facing glass pours in intense, hot light, while the AC needed to keep those big volumes comfortable wrings the humidity out of the air. The result is the classic modern-Austin combination: plants that scorch and crisp even though they are technically getting plenty of light. Matching the plant to that exact light, and supporting humidity where it counts, is most of the job. See choosing plants for big windows and plants and Austin AC air.
The water is the same hard, chloraminated Colorado River supply the rest of Austin runs on, so expect the mineral buildup I describe in my Austin hard water guide.
